Broken Panes

When a window pane is damaged or cracked air can flow through more easily. This can reduce the effectiveness of the window as an insulation and protects against the elements. Depending on the season, this can cause warm or cold air to escape or enter your home, causing an increase in heating and cooling costs.

If the crack is not too deep, you might be able to utilize an adhesive tape with strong-hold. This is a temporary fix however, and may only prevent the crack from getting worse. A reputable window repair service can fix any broken glass that has been smashed on double-glazed windows.

It could be risky and challenging to replace a window pane on your own. If the crack is large and difficult to get rid of You can try applying strips of masking tap in a crisscrossing design. If the crack isn't too large, you can hold it steady and use a razor blade to cut it away from the frame. Wear gloves and a mask while cutting the glass. When the pane is cut free it is necessary to place it flat on a few layers of newspaper to catch any pieces that may fall.

To install a new pane, you will need to purchase replacement glass and then prepare the frame. Take measurements of the opening of the frame and subtract 1/16 to 1/8 inch in both directions to ensure that your new pane will fit properly. Then, you can have your replacement glass cut to this measurement at your local glass shop or hardware store. If you have wood frames, purchase points for glaziers from a hardware store to install along the edges of your new pane. Place the points in a way they can allow for expansion and contraction, while keeping the putty in place against the glass.

Spread a thick layer with a putty blade once your new pane is installed. You can use a linseed oil-based putting like Sarco or a lesser product such as Dap glazing compound. Fill any gaps that exist between the frame and pane with your chosen compound. Be sure to smooth the compound to ensure that it is level and even all around your pane.

Water Leaks

Water leaks around windows' frame or sash can be a frequent problem. This happens when the sealant on windows has worn out and needs to be replaced. Water leaks around the window can cause damage to the plaster or drywall and cause damp walls.

A good quality double glazed window will come with a gasket which is able to compress when the sash is closed. The water that enters this area should be drained through the weepholes of the frame. Sometimes, the weep hole may become blocked due to dirt and debris. The weather stripping could need to be replaced.

The lintel on top of the upvc window repairs could also be an area of leaks. The builders who built the house may not have been aware of the importance of allowing the lintel to drain properly, or they could have covered it in concrete leaving a gap that rainwater could enter and get trapped, and cause dampness or rot to the wood. The builders could have placed bent fascia boards over the windows to ensure that water is directed properly. This will stop water entering the building.

A gap between the glass panes of a double-glazed window can also be the cause of leaks. It is possible that gas argon or Krypton that should be between the glass to create insulation has escaped of the windows due to a worn out seal. Although this is not the most serious issue associated with leaky windows, it will have a negative impact on energy efficiency. It should be addressed as soon as is possible. Condensation

Condensation may be a problem with older double-glazed windows and doors. However, it's typically an easy fix. This is due to a lack of air flow around the window. It usually happens in rooms such as kitchens or bathrooms. Droplets of water on the glass surface of the glass are a clear indication of condensation. These droplets will rapidly evaporate when the window is heated by sunlight. However, if the problem persists it is worth investigating further.

Another indicator of condensation is if you hear water drippy. This is likely due to a broken seal between the two glass panes. If you hear this sound, it is highly recommended as it will stop cold drafts from entering your home. This kind of issue can also lead to mould in the long term It is therefore recommended to fix the window when you can.

A professional can examine your window and suggest the best solution. Professional companies will remove the glass that is affected and blow hot air between the two panes. This will evaporate any moisture that remains and ensure that a high-quality seal is reapplied.

Windowpane seals that fail are the main cause of condensation problems with double glazing. Cool air enters double-paned windows when the seal breaks and they begin to fog up. If this occurs it's possible that simple fixes could aid, but in most instances, the best option is to replace the window.

Most double glazed windows have a'spacer' bar that sits between the two panes of glass. The spacer bar is filled with desiccant which sucks up any moisture that may occur, therefore preventing it from reaching the glass panes, causing condensation. This spacer bar is prone to breaking or cracking and it's often necessary to replace your entire window.

Double-glazed windows are sold as an Insulated Glass unit (IGU). This is what consists of the two glass panes, a gap between them, and Double glazed window repairs Near Me an insulating rubber seal that prevents water from getting into the insulating gap. Certain IGUs contain Argon, a gas that keeps heat from leaving the house and helps save money on energy costs.

If one of the IGUs is damaged an alternative pane can be purchased from a window manufacturer and then fitted to the frame. This is normally far cheaper than replacing the entire window and is far more affordable for the majority of households.

Glass-Replacement-150x150.jpgDepending on the kind of window you have and the condition of the frame, it might be possible to simply repair the damaged window. This is usually the case if it has only developed a few small cracks, but has not shattered. If your double-glazed window has completely broken, then it's probably best to replace the entire glass unit as well as the window sash.
